資料庫系統概論第 十二章 多表格資料庫設計   上一頁    

12-4 自我挑戰

內容:

  • 12-4-1 人事管理系統

  • 12-4-2 員工休閒活動管理系統

  • 12-4-3 餐廳管理系統

  • 12-4-4 高爾夫會員管理系統

12-4-1 人事管理系統

(A) 系統需求與規格

『大石精密公司』接受委託製造各種生產機械,目前大約有 300 位員工,老闆期望建立一套人事管理系統,希望有下列功能:

  • 可登錄、刪除或更新員工資料。

  • 可查詢每位員工服務部門、底薪、職務加級、加班時數。

  • 每月可計算員工薪資表。

  • 可查詢各部門負責人、員工名單,並計算各部門薪資結構如何。

  • 全公司內員工的薪點、加級與津貼都有統一計算標準。

(B) 資料收集

系統分析師到現場收集到商品資料如下:

  • (a) 員工資料有:員工編號、姓名、地址、電話、性別、出生日期、服務部門、薪點、與職務。

  • (b)薪資類別:薪點、薪點金額、加級金額、加級基點。

  • (c)服務部門:部門名稱、部門地區(高雄、台北、上海、、)

(C) 完成事項

(1) 資料庫邏輯設計。

(2) E-R 關係圖轉換資料表與正規化。

(3) 實體建置。

(4) 匯入測試資料。

(5) 測試資料庫功能。

(6) 資料庫效能分析。

(C) 提示

以下是提示資料庫關聯圖,並非完整設計。

12-4-2 員工休閒活動管理系統

(A) 系統需求與規格

『研技半導體設計公司』是接受委託設計多項功能半導體的公司,目前大約有 500 位員工,每天透過電腦設計半導體結構,公司有感於員工過於忙碌,需要有適當休閒活動以調適心身,才能發揮最大工作效益。在公司裡成立許多休閒活動讓同仁參加,但已希望了解每位同仁參與程度,才能給予適當輔導。因此,委託建立一套員工休閒活動管理系統,希望有下列功能:

  • 員工可以到各項活動社團報名參加。

  • 可查詢員工參加了那些社團,並可量化員工身心調適量多寡。

  • 可查詢社團裡有哪些員工參加,並可計算社團花費成本多寡。

  • 可查詢調適量過低或過高的員工。

  • 可查詢花費成本過高或過低的社團。

(B) 資料收集

系統分析師到現場收集到員工與社團資料如下:

  • 員工資料:員工編號、姓名、地址、電話、性別、出生日期。

  • 社團資料:社團名稱、每位參與者費用、身心調適量。

(C) 提示

(D) 完成事項

(1) 資料庫邏輯設計。

(2) E-R 關係圖轉換資料表與正規化。

(3) 實體建置。

(4) 匯入測試資料。

(5) 測試資料庫功能。

(6) 資料庫效能分析。

12-4-3 餐廳管理系統

(A) 系統需求與規格

『真善美健康美食餐廳』是一家提供健康美食的專屬餐廳,期望建立一套餐廳管理系統,希望有下列功能:

  • 按照桌次點菜,點菜完畢後除了顯示金額外,還顯示卡路里的總和。

  • 可隨時查詢桌次菜單。

  • 會計部門可依照桌次收費。

  • 可統計分析各樣菜被點用的狀況。

(B) 資料收集

系統分析師到現場收集到該餐廳的資料如下:

  • 菜單資料:菜單名稱、單價(大、中、小)、卡路里(大、中、小)

  • 桌次:1 ~ 10 桌。

(C) 完成事項

(1) 資料庫邏輯設計。

(2) E-R 關係圖轉換資料表與正規化。

(3) 實體建置。

(4) 匯入測試資料。

(5) 測試資料庫功能。

(6) 資料庫效能分析。

12-4-4 高爾夫會員管理系統

(A) 系統需求與規格

『長青高爾夫球場』期望建立一套會員管理系統,紀錄與分析員會繳費與消費情況如何,希望有下列功能:

  • 可登錄會員資料與查詢繳費狀況。

  • 可查詢會員消費狀況。

  • 可查詢消費最高與最低會員,消費較高會員可以升級會員等級,享受不同待遇。

(B) 資料收集

系統分析師到現場收集到的資料如下:

  • 會員資料:姓名、地址、電話、性別、地址、出生日期。

  • 會員等級:金卡(年費 2 萬元)、白金卡(年費 1.5 萬元)、貴賓卡(年費 1 萬元)

  • 臨場消費:假日:1200 元、非假日:1000 元。

(C) 提示

(D) 完成事項

(1) 資料庫邏輯設計。

(2) E-R 關係圖轉換資料表與正規化。

(3) 實體建置。

(4) 匯入測試資料。

(5) 測試資料庫功能。

(6) 資料庫效能分析。

翻轉工作室:粘添壽

 

資料庫系統概論(含邏輯設計)

 

 

翻轉電子書系列: